While we enjoy the festivities, let's remember to prioritize the safety of ourselves and our loved ones. Whether you're attending a fireworks display, hosting a backyard barbecue, or spending time outdoors, please keep in mind these essential safety tips:
🔥 Fireworks Safety: If you plan to enjoy fireworks, make sure to follow local laws and regulations. Always keep a safe distance, never attempt to relight a dud firework, and have a designated adult in charge of handling them.
🍔 Food Safety: As you indulge in delicious Fourth of July treats, remember to practice proper food safety. Keep perishable foods refrigerated, avoid cross-contamination, and ensure meats are cooked thoroughly.
☀️ Sun Protection: If you're spending time outdoors, protect yourself from the sun's harmful rays. Apply sunscreen, wear a hat and sunglasses, and seek shade during the hottest parts of the day.
🐾 Pet Safety: Our furry friends are part of the family too! Keep them safe by providing a quiet and secure space away from fireworks, ensuring they have proper identification, and never leaving them unattended near open flames or hot grills.
